"We offer new support options and therefor the forums are now in read-only mode! Please check out our Support Center for more information." - Vuforia Engine Team

Trained Model Recognition Not Working

I am not sure if this is a Model Target issue, or a Magic Leap issue, but I wanted to post to see if anyone knows what the potential issue would be.

Using the Model Target Generator, I was able to create a model target, add a 360-view (with proper scaling and viewing bounds), and create the .unitypackage to import into my project. Using this untrained model target, the virtual model was properly overlaid on top of the physical object (while running on the Magic Leap).

Next, I created a new training set database, basing it off of the working untrained model target described above. It is processed, exported, and imported into Unity. However, after I switched the model target source to this trained dataset, the application can no longer recognize the physical object.

 

It's odd to me that a trained model wouldn't be able to recognize the object at least at the same basic level as the untrained model. Any thoughts on where to go from here?

jsteinerman

Wed, 01/15/2020 - 15:47

Hey jschluet - thanks for letting us know about that! I've seen this issue as well and have passed your experience on to our Engineering team. We're looking into this now.

Have you tried testing this trained 360 model target on another device (iOS/Android) - does it work there?

Hi @jschulet,

Could you please provide the .unitypackage for review?

Thank you.

Vuforia Engine Support